Latest Patents

Among his latest patents, two stand out due to their groundbreaking nature. The first is a **Compound Semiconductor Monolithic Frequency Source and Actuator**. This invention features a piezoelectric device built on a semiconductor that integrates electronic circuitry. To enhance performance, a cooling device is employed to lower the temperature of the resonator, allowing for effective microphonic compensation at low temperatures. Furthermore, the invention explores the use of piezoelectric materials that function at high temperatures, providing a solution for creating high-temperature frequency sources.

The second significant patent is a **Fiber Optic Sensor for Magnetic Bearings**. This innovative sensor comprises a stator and rotor, alongside an optical transmit/receive fiber. It operates by propagating light across the gap between the stator and rotor, measuring the distance based on reflected light intensity. The system is designed to optimize the control of electromagnetic coils within the magnetic bearing, and it offers the potential for remote optical source detection with the possibility of multiplexing techniques to enhance functionality.
